Business traveling is a broad term which pertains to virtually any kind of travel which is done for business purposes. It may come as a surprise, but business or corporate travel is a whole lot much more varied and diversified than individuals know. In fact, there are many different types of business travel which each have their own distinct components and advantages. For example, one of the most prominent business travel examples are company retreats. Today, businesses are putting more and more effort into establishing a sense of team and seeking to engage their workers. There is no better way to boost morale and synergy by encouraging staff members to spend some high quality time with each other outside of the workplace. Exciting company retreats which are far away from the office are a superb opportunity to reaffirm your company's values and develop partnerships both within teams and between different company divisions. The secret to an effective business retreat is planning and organisation; flight times, accommodation, dinners and team-building activities all really need to be well thought out beforehand. Within the business travel and tourism industry, there are typically new trends emerging. For instance, one of the most latest business travel trends is the surge in 'bleisure' travel. So, what does this mean? To put it simply, bleisure more info is a combination of both business and leisure. To put it simply, it gives staff members the opportunity to add some additional leisure time into their business trips. Instead of flying out to another nation and spending the entire time in a workplace, bleisure travel gives individuals the chance to actually do a bit of sightseeing outside of the workplace hours. As an example, if they are flying out on business for a week, they may be able to have an early finish on the Friday so that they can explore some of the tourist sites. Actually, some individuals have actually even been given permission to bring their significant others and family along with them too, specifically if the business travel includes a longer-term project, such as setting up a new global office. Ultimately, the importance of business tourism lies in the fact that it can lead to amazing business opportunities. For instance, one of the major features of business travel is client meetings. In recent years, the rise of globalisation and the internet has led to increasingly more companies seeking business relationships with clients that are not even in the same country, let alone city. Huge business ventures between firms or clients typically require some in-person interaction. Trust and open communication is the cornerstone of any kind of successful business relationship; nevertheless, this is a lot more difficult to accomplish this when you are only looking at somebody through a computer display or via email correspondence. Having actual human connection and contact is vital, which is why a great deal of companies will dedicate the time, effort and resources to attend in-person client meetings, even if it means travelling to the other side of the globe.
